  1. Jun 17, 2024 · Aloha Oe” translates to “Farewell to you” in English, and its lyrics beautifully depict a sense of parting and longing for the loved ones left behind. The song paints a picture of natural beauty, with rain sweeping by cliffs, gliding through trees, and the ‘ahihi lehua (a type of hibiscus) blooming in the valley.

"Aloha ʻOe" ("Farewell to Thee") is a Hawaiian folk song written c. 1878 by Queen Liliʻuokalani, who was then known as Princess of the Hawaiian Kingdom.

  7. 3 days ago · The composer of "Aloha ʻOe" and numerous other works, she wrote her autobiography Hawaiʻi's Story by Hawaiʻi's Queen during her imprisonment following the overthrow. Liliʻuokalani was born in 1838 in Honolulu, on the island of Oʻahu.
